Output 5341f81dce6e05f7bf8aae17fb16e25d42e81feea59cd5de98733ab9d255ddf7:1

value
349032893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8947e47f766a629440214f3b74415e85fa44618a OP_EQUAL
address
3ECtd1QfVuE5FCaX8W5KKb2NQRsFoQjxJK
transaction
5341f81dce6e05f7bf8aae17fb16e25d42e81feea59cd5de98733ab9d255ddf7
confirmations
256471
spent
true